在數據庫中存儲類層次結構的另一種策略稱為 Joined Table。它有一個特殊的註釋:
@Inheritance(strategy = InheritanceType.JOINED)
我們班級的一個例子:
@Inheritance(strategy = InheritanceType.JOINED)
@Entity
class User {
int id;
String name;
LocalDate birthday;
}
@Entity
class Employee extends User {
String occupation;
int salary;
LocalDate join;
}
@Entity
class Client extends User {
String address;
}
當使用這個註解時,Hibernate 將期望在數據庫中為每個類及其子類創建一個單獨的表。從它們中選擇數據時,您將不得不使用 SQL JOIN 運算符。
數據庫架構示例:
CREATE TABLE user {
id INT,
name VARCHAR,
birthday DATE
}
CREATE TABLE employee {
id INT,
occupation VARCHAR,
salary INT,
join DATE
}
CREATE TABLE client {
id INT,
address VARCHAR
}
如果您決定從表中獲取某些客戶端的數據,那麼 Hibernate 將不得不使用 JOIN 來連接表:
SELECT u.id, u.name, u.birthday, c.address FROM user u JOIN client c ON u.id = c.id;
@PrimaryKeyJoinColumn
子實體類在表中有一列引用父實體類的對象 ID。此列的名稱默認等於父類列的名稱。
例子:
@Inheritance(strategy = InheritanceType.JOINED)
@Entity
class User {
@Id
int user_identifier;
String name;
LocalDate birthday;
}
@Entity
class Employee extends User {
String occupation;
int salary;
LocalDate join;
}
@Entity
class Client extends User {
String address;
}
然後數據庫表將如下所示:
CREATE TABLE user {
user_identifier INT,
name VARCHAR,
birthday DATE
}
CREATE TABLE employee {
user_identifier INT,
occupation VARCHAR,
salary INT,
join DATE
}
CREATE TABLE client {
user_identifier INT,
address VARCHAR
}
如果要覆蓋依賴表中的列名,則需要使用@PrimaryKeyJoinColumn註解 。例子:
@Inheritance(strategy = InheritanceType.JOINED)
@Entity
class User {
@Id
int user_identifier;
String name;
LocalDate birthday;
}
@Entity
@PrimaryKeyJoinColumn(name=”user_id”)
class Employee extends User {
String occupation;
int salary;
LocalDate join;
}
@Entity
@PrimaryKeyJoinColumn(name=”user_id2”)
class Client extends User {
String address;
}
然後數據庫表將如下所示:
CREATE TABLE user {
user_identifier INT,
name VARCHAR,
birthday DATE
}
CREATE TABLE employee {
user_id INT,
occupation VARCHAR,
salary INT,
join DATE
}
CREATE TABLE client {
user_id2 INT,
address VARCHAR
}
